All gaging and determining equipment must be checked periodically to ensure that it is capable of the job it was planned to do-- to gauge parts properly. In the substantial majority of cases, this simply includes validating that these calipers, micrometers, as well as examination and dial indications meet their performance requirements. In others, it requires adjusting their efficiency to meet requirements. However all the same, this procedure of calibration has to be done often, view source.

Ideally, gages would certainly be checked prior to and after every dimension to make certain that absolutely nothing changed between the time the gage was last adjusted and the moment it was made use of. This circumstance is not functional, nevertheless, and, most of the times, modern-day gages are really dependable and also do not vary a lot in their daily usage. For huge and medium-sized business that use hundreds of gages, the inquiry frequently comes to be whether to perform calibration internal or to make use of an acquired calibration facility. Possessing a multitude of gages includes a huge financial investment, not only in the single expenses of buying the gages themselves however in the repeating costs related to adjusting them. How to calibrate is a choice that should be considered carefully.

For the very tiny shop, nevertheless, hand tools and also gages can be calibrated flawlessly well which calibration recorded appropriately appropriate in-house. To abide by various ISO criteria, such a shop should: have a good set of dimensional criteria (gage blocks); recognize the gage efficiency standards; recognize each gage with a private serial tag; have a composed calibration treatment; and document that process and also maintain records of results. The store also must repeat the calibration procedure at routine and also controlled intervals.

Whether the gage is a caliper, micrometer, or dial or examination indicator, the basic calibration process is the same. It starts with an adjusted criterion, which normally includes a set of licensed gage blocks, although those gage blocks don't need to be of the highest quality for fundamental, reduced resolution devices. A low-cost set with correct accreditation can be an excellent basis for a calibration process.

Gages are generally made to nationwide or international requirements. You can establish screening standards either from the typical or the manufacturer's requirements. These performance specifications will certainly be the core of any type of recorded calibration treatment you build.

This documents ought to include: the tools for performing the calibration; exactly how and also where the procedure will be performed; the efficiency standards; and also who will certainly carry out and witness the tests. It's additionally a good idea, as part of the beginning process, to make a checklist of possible resources of error that might lower gage performance. The procedure needs to include a general evaluation of the gage making certain it's working well as well as has no evident damage or used parts, that the points are secured in place, and that the gage is appropriately affixed to the examination component. Gage recognition likewise is a straightforward but vital component of the calibration procedure. Having a special individual monitoring tag or long-term noting on the gage is vital. With this and appropriately filed test results, a shop will have the historic information required to demonstrate that the gage is "in control" within its calibration process.
